If the PickPath Optimizer admin account gets locked out (happens more than you'd think after the Brindlewood warehouse migration), don't panic. Log into the standby console, flip the override toggle, and re-seed the scheduler. You'll be prompted for the recovery passphrase, which is:

recovery phrase for fajeg-hagug: holox-fenmir

Q2 Planning Note — Finance Team, Ashgrove Technical Group

Hiring in the Instruments division is frozen effective Monday, through the end of Q3. Cancel all open requisitions; reallocate recruiting spend to the shared pool. Backfills need CFO approval. Expected saving: roughly 1.1m against plan. Accrue severance reserves unchanged. Contractor extensions capped at 60 days. Update the rolling forecast by Friday and flag variances above 2%. The underlying business rationale is set out in the confidential note below.

management briefing: The renewal with Zoraelax Group closes at $10 million a year, 15 percent below the last contract. Project Ralael slips by six weeks because of the audit delay.

Title: Scheduler double-waters bed 3 after DST shift

New folks: the Verdella scheduler stores watering slots in local time. After the clock change, slot 06:00 fires twice, soaking the herb bed. Fix: store UTC, convert at display. Repro on the Oakhollow test rig only. To reproduce, install the firmware identified by the token below.

build token for hafop-kahog: htk31_a432ac515d5bb1362002c1e1a7e80ef